How to fill out the AU NSW ADV7065 online

Filling out the AU NSW ADV7065 form correctly is crucial for ensuring a smooth transition between managing agents or property owners. This guide provides a straightforward, step-by-step approach to completing the form online, making the process clearer for all users, regardless of their legal experience.

Follow the steps to successfully complete the AU NSW ADV7065 form.

  1. Click the 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the form and open it in your editor.
  2. In the 'Tenancy Details' section, enter the address of the rented premises and the relevant postcode. Ensure accuracy to avoid any processing delays.
  3. Next, fill out the 'Tenant/s' section. Provide the first name and family name of all tenants. Include their phone numbers in the designated fields.
  4. Move to the 'New Owner' section. Indicate whether the new owner is self-managing the rented premises by circling 'Yes' or 'No.' Fill out their name, address, postcode, and contact numbers.
  5. Complete the 'Managing Agent' section by indicating if the agency will manage the premises. Again, circle 'Yes' or 'No,' and provide the agent’s ID number, name, address, and contact information.
  6. In the 'Approval' section, the previous managing agent or owner must sign to authorize the changes. Ensure that this step is completed for the registration of the changes.
  7. After filling in all the sections, review the form for accuracy. Make any necessary corrections before finalizing it.
  8. Once all information is complete and correct, you can save your changes, download, print, or share the form as needed.

When a property is sold in NSW, the existing tenants usually remain in place, and their lease continues under the new owner. The sale should not affect your tenancy rights, as the new landlord must honor the terms stipulated in your lease agreement.
